Overview

Colombia maintains an active force of 428,000 military personnel. Colombia allocates $14B to defense.

Colombia operates 437 military aircraft; Aruba has no significant air force.

Colombia operates a 233-ship naval fleet; Aruba has no navy.

Neither Aruba nor Colombia possesses nuclear weapons.
